The Three Pillars of Longevity Fitness
To stay healthy as you age, focus on three main types of exercises: cardiovascular training, functional strength training, and social activities.
Cardiovascular Training: Cardio is critical for keeping your heart in shape. Regular aerobic exercise strengthens the heart and lungs, which is vital for lasting health. Engaging in various forms of cardio not only optimizes heart health but can also decrease the risk of numerous chronic diseases, allowing you to maintain your vitality.
Functional Strength Training: Did you know that starting around age 40, you lose approximately 1% of muscle mass each year? Strength training fights this decline and strengthens your bones, which is crucial as you age. This type of training allows for better mobility and function in everyday tasks, reducing the risk of injury and falls.
Social Activities: Exercising doesn’t have to be a solitary endeavor! Engaging in group sports or fitness classes provides a sense of community and boosts motivation. Socializing while you work out can improve mood and reduce stress, which ultimately contributes to longevity.
How Much Exercise is Enough?
Wondering about the optimal amount of exercise to promote longevity? The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ention recommends a minimum of 150 minutes per week of moderate-intensity aerobic exercise, or about 75 minutes of vigorous activity. Even small amounts of physical activity can make a difference, so remember, every bit counts!
Top Exercises to Keep You Young
Here’s a quick list of the best exercises you can include in your routine to enhance longevity:
Squats: Add strength to your legs and maintain mobility.
Walking: A simple yet effective cardiovascular exercise.
Resistance Training: Fight muscle loss and strengthen bones.
Yoga: Improve flexibility and reduce stress.
Dancing: Engage socially while getting a great workout.
